OK. Today I felt like a real brewer. 33 lbs. of grain. 70 qt mash tun at capacity. 15 gallon kettle at capacity. Why? All for a 10 gallon batch of Russian Imperial Stout for the clubs December 2010 competition.




I started by crushing the grain. Normally I fill about 3/4 of a bucket. Not this time...

















After heating 12 gallons of water in the big kettle I mashed in my big 70 quart mash tun. Again, this was a test of capacity...










After sparging I had over 12 gallons of wort to boil. It took two of us, thanks Kevin, to lift the kettle onto the burner.











In the end, a potentially wonderful 1.090 beer, ready for fermentation.
